*{font-feature-settings:"palt"}#cf-tbl{width:100%}#cf-tbl p{margin:0}#cf-tbl table{width:100%;border-collapse:collapse;border:solid #ccc;border-width:1px;color:#444}#cf-tbl table tr th,#cf-tbl table tr td{padding:.5em;text-align:left;vertical-align:middle;border:solid #ccc;border-width:1px}#cf-tbl table tr th{width:35%;background:#eee}#cf-tbl table tr td{background:#fff}@media screen and (max-width:768px){#cf-tbl{width:100%}#cf-tbl table,#cf-tbl table tbody,#cf-tbl table tr,#cf-tbl table tr th,#cf-tbl table tr td{display:block}#cf-tbl table{width:100%;border-width:0 0 1px}#cf-tbl table tr th,#cf-tbl table tr td{width:100%;padding:3% 5%}#cf-tbl table tr td{border-width:0 1px}}.list-vertical .wpcf7-list-item{display:block;width:100%;margin:0 0 5px}.list-vertical .wpcf7-list-item:last-child{margin:0}.list-mt10{display:block;margin:10px 0 0}#cf-tbl table input.wpcf7-form-control.wpcf7-text{margin:0}input.wpcf7-form-control.wpcf7-text,textarea.wpcf7-form-control.wpcf7-textarea{margin:0 !important}.required{font-size:.8em;padding:5px;background:#dc5014;color:#fff;border-radius:3px;margin-right:5px}.optional{font-size:.8em;padding:5px;background:#78c2b8;color:#fff;border-radius:3px;margin-right:5px}input.wpcf7-form-control.wpcf7-text,textarea.wpcf7-form-control.wpcf7-textarea{width:100%;padding:8px 15px;margin-right:10px;margin-top:10px;margin-bottom:10px;border:1px solid #ccc;border-radius:3px;background-color:#fafafa}textarea.wpcf7-form-control.wpcf7-textarea{height:200px}.submit_area p{margin:0}input.wpcf7-submit{display:block;padding:15px;width:400px;background:#089bcc;color:#fff;font-size:18px;font-weight:700;border-radius:5px;border-color:#089bcc;margin:15px auto 0}@media screen and (max-width:768px){#cf-tbl table tr td{padding:5%}.list-mt10-br{display:block}.list-mt10-br-2{display:block;margin:10px 0 0}input.wpcf7-submit{width:250px}.text-area input.wpcf7-form-control.wpcf7-text{min-height:200px}}input.wpcf7-submit:hover{background-color:#232323;border-color:#232323;transform:translateY(-4px);opacity:1}span.wpcf7-not-valid-tip,.wpcf7-response-output.wpcf7-validation-errors{color:red;font-weight:600}.grecaptcha-badge{margin:0 auto}#cf-check{text-align:center;margin:50px 0}#cf-check p{margin:15px 0}#cf-check a{color:#089bcc;text-decoration:underline}.wpcf7-spinner{display:none!important}.wpcf7-form.sent .wpcf7-response-output{display:none}@keyframes fadeInUp2{from{opacity:0;transform:translate3d(0,20%,0)}to{opacity:1;transform:none}}.fadeInUp{animation-name:fadeInUp2 !important}@keyframes fadeInRight2{from{opacity:0;transform:translate3d(20%,0,0)}to{opacity:1;transform:none}}.fadeInRight{animation-name:fadeInRight2 !important}@keyframes fadeInDown2{from{opacity:0;transform:translate3d(0,-20%,0)}to{opacity:1;transform:none}}.fadeInDown{animation-name:fadeInDown2 !important}@keyframes fadeInLeft2{from{opacity:0;transform:translate3d(-20%,0,0)}to{opacity:1;transform:none}}.fadeInLeft{animation-name:fadeInLeft2 !important}.custoumShowLeft,.custoumShowRight,.custoumShowUp,.custoumShowDown{overflow:hidden}.custoumShowLeft:after,.custoumShowRight:after,.custoumShowUp:after,.custoumShowDown:after,.custoumShowSpecial:after,.custoumShowLeft>div,.custoumShowRight>div,.custoumShowUp>div,.custoumShowDown>div{animation-delay:.2s;animation-fill-mode:forwards;animation-duration:.9s;animation-timing-function:ease-in-out;visibility:hidden}.custoumShowLeft:after,.custoumShowRight:after,.custoumShowUp:after,.custoumShowDown:after{content:'';position:absolute;top:0;left:0;height:100%;width:100%;z-index:1;background:#189cc0}@keyframes custoumVisible{50%{visibility:hidden}100%{visibility:visible}}.custoumShowLeft>div,.custoumShowRight>div,.custoumShowUp>div,.custoumShowDown>div{animation-name:custoumVisible}@keyframes custoumShowLeftAfter{0%{visibility:visible;transform:translate3d(100%,0,0)}50%{transform:translate3d(0,0,0)}100%{transform:translate3d(-100%,0,0)}}@keyframes custoumShowRightAfter{0%{visibility:visible;transform:translate3d(-100%,0,0)}50%{transform:translate3d(0,0,0)}100%{transform:translate3d(100%,0,0)}}@keyframes custoumShowUpAfter{0%{visibility:visible;transform:translate3d(0,100%,0)}50%{transform:translate3d(0,0,0)}100%{transform:translate3d(0,-100%,0)}}@keyframes custoumShowDownAfter{0%{visibility:visible;transform:translate3d(0,-100%,0)}50%{transform:translate3d(0,0,0)}100%{transform:translate3d(0,100%,0)}}.custoumShowLeft:after{animation-name:custoumShowLeftAfter}.custoumShowRight:after{animation-name:custoumShowRightAfter}.custoumShowUp:after{animation-name:custoumShowUpAfter}.custoumShowDown:after{animation-name:custoumShowDownAfter}.pc_br{display:block}@media screen and (max-width:768px){.sp_br{display:block}.pc_br{display:none}input[type=date]{width:50%;box-sizing:border-box}}.font150{font-size:150%}@media (min-width:751px){a[href^="tel:"]{pointer-events:none;cursor:default}}